A B O U T T H E J U R O R


 

David Dickerson

Founder & Principal, Grace Dickerson Marketing Consultancy

David is a senior-level professional with over thirty-years of experience in marketing communications for the aviation industry. Known for his high standards of service and strategic vision, his firm’s work is seen worldwide, and he is a frequently quoted source for aerospace publications and industry resource groups. 

His work through the years includes strategic oversight and management of projects on behalf of several Fortune 500 clients including: IBM, Kimberly Clark, and Textron, as well as both Continental and American Airlines.

    In addition, David has overseen the successful global launch of products and programs for numerous aviation industry leaders in both civilian and military markets, including Cessna, Embraer, Pilatus, TBM, Eurocopter, Kodiak, Pratt & Whitney Canada, Dassault, Piaggio, Bell Helicopter, Rockwell, Thrush, Atlantic Aviation, and Gogo. He has also been a guest lecturer for the D.B. O’Maley College of Business MBA program at Embry Riddle Aeronautical University and at the Ringling College of Art & Design.

    David is a pilot with commercial multi-engine and instrument ratings in fixed and rotary-wing aircraft. He has served on the Experimental Aircraft Association’s Partner Steering Committee and the Corporate Angel Network’s industry sponsorship team and is a member of the Board of Directors for the Wings Over the Rockies Air & Space Museum. He was also recently appointed as a Court Appointed Special Advocate for children. David, along with his wife, resides in Colorado where his firm, Grace Dickerson, is based.

GOLD JUROR’S AWARD

Angelena Vargas

Art in Action

  • Spreading the intrinsic power of creativity along the joy of self-expression – and emphasizing the importance of both to a large swath of the community – is an extremely worthy mission. This project seamlessly conveys its objectives and how best to attain them through clever and engaging strategy and executions. This entry clearly exhibits an understanding of audience/community needs and have addresses them with complete and compelling tactics – from cohesive merchandizing and media channels to thoughtful events and curriculum. All of which nicely capture and covey the importance of the tasks at hand, while providing engaging, hands-on ways to accomplish them.

 

SILVER JUROR’S AWARD

Lilli Jones, Sarah Davis, Lucas Durso & Samantha Balikowa

Creative Cultivations

  • Outstanding research has yielded an excellent graphic presentation of both a timely problem and a compelling way to address it. This project encourages audience engagement and meaningful reasons why in ways that educate and entertain viewers. And, in so doing, promotes awareness and lively participation. In addition, these students have created an extremely comprehensive and very viable, real-world plan of action that could easily be implemented – not only on the Ringling Campus – but franchised to other campuses as well, bringing a very impressive solution to a clearly identified need.

 

BRONZE JUROR’S AWARD

Jennifer Villagomez

Frame Papers

  • Stop-you-in-your-tracks imagery, combined with art direction, design and content that creates a surprise at every turn of the page, this magazine project exhibits a clear understanding of its primary audience and how best to draw them back into the print medium. A bit shocking? Perhaps. Fun and appealing? Absolutely. The ability to keep the reader wondering where the next photo spread, ad, or editorial will take them makes this project a delightful alternative to the sameness of other mediums, as well as to current publications in the space. Well done.
